Transaction 8ab54016702041a866b00c5b9e6ada0ecdf470beabe7032fee26d27e5aa0c7c9
1 Input
1 Output
-
8ab54016702041a866b00c5b9e6ada0ecdf470beabe7032fee26d27e5aa0c7c9:0
- value
- 689940000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 83b96214998146dc98dd069ee5462ba4f8c5750d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D1VbmxwWx7XtPFg9nc6VHPx98yM8AV4T3